Page 4: Biodegradation And Bioremediation

• Bioremediation is a process of removing or degrading the toxic pollutant from the environment by using microorganism .

• commonly used micro organisms are, Pseudomonas,Flavobacterium,Arthrobacter, and Azotobacter

• Bioremediation focuses on different sources they are called as different names. plant------------- phytoremediation fungi------------- mycoremediation

Bioremediation

•Degradation or Transformation of a substance into new compounds through biochemical reactions or the actions of microorganisms such as bacteria.

Biodegradation

Page 14: Biodegradation And Bioremediation

The bacterium Deinococcus radiodurans(the most radioresistant organism known) has been modified to consume and digest toluene and ionic mercury from highly radioactive nuclear waste.

Strains of Deinococcus radiodurans
